    Abstract The major issue of luminescent carbon quantum dots (CQDs) is the solubility in wide range of solvent and disappearance of luminescence behavior in its solid state due to aggregation caused quenching. To resolve this issue, in the present work, we have tuned the solubility of carbon quantum dots in different kinds of solvents through surface functionalization technique. Here, we have synthesized three sets of alkyl amine functionalized carbon quantum dots from citric acid and alkyl amine by solvothermal method. We have observed that the solubility of CQDs increases from aqueous medium to organic medium with increasing length of hydrophobic alkyl chains attached at the surface of CQDs. It is seen that n-butyl amine functionalized CQDs (C₄-CQD) are soluble in any type of solvents. Here we have also observed that the C₄-CQD shows aggregation induced emission instead of aggregation caused quenching in solid state and shows bright yellow luminescence color upon excitation. Besides this, we also report selective detection of both dinitroaniline (DNA) and dinitrophenol (DNP) using this C₄-CQD via fluorescence quenching and colorimetric methods. In organic medium both shows significant quenching with emission peak of carbon quantum dots is red shifted (∼30 nm) in presence of DNP whereas no significant peak shift is observed for DNA. CQDs containing paper strip shows yellow spot in presence of DNP but no such characteristic color is appeared after addition of DNA. Using these two techniques, we have selectively identified both DNA and DNP among other nitro compounds by our as-synthesized carbon dots.

    Abstract During the past few years, intensive research has been carried out to design new functional materials for superior electrochemical applications. Due to low storage capacity and low charge transport, silica based glasses have not yet been investigated for their supercapacitive behavior. Therefore, in the present study, a multilayered structure of silica-based nanoglass and reduced graphene oxide has been designed to remarkably enhance the specific capacitance by exploiting the porosity, large surface area, sufficient dangling bonds in the nanoglass and high electrical conductivity of rGO. The charge transport in the composite structure is also investigated to understand the electrochemical properties. It is found that Simmons tunneling or direct tunneling is the dominant mechanism of charge conduction between the graphene layers via the potential barrier of silica nanoglass phase. We believe that this study will open up a new area in the design of glass-based two-dimensional nanocomposites for superior supercapacitor applications.
